TRIM38 Suppresses Breast Cancer Progression via Modulating SQSTM1 Ubiquitination and Autophagic Flux

open access: yesAdvanced Science, EarlyView.
TRIM38, an E3 ubiquitin ligase, suppresses breast cancer progression by inhibiting proliferation, migration, and invasion. Downregulated in breast tumor, its loss correlates with poor prognosis. Mechanistically, TRIM38 mediates K63‐linked ubiquitination of SQSTM1/p62 at K420, disrupting SQSTM1‐LC3 interaction and blocking autophagic flux.

Mechanical Glass‐Backsheet Photovoltaic Modules Delamination: Toward Materials Recycling

open access: yesAdvanced Energy and Sustainability Research, EarlyView.
A new technology based on sanding has been developed to collect most of the materials contained in a photovoltaic (PV) module in the form of powders. A pilot line is now operational. This technology is specifically suited for Glass//Backsheet PV panels, which represent today the vast majority of the end of life PV panels.
